Building Access: Interview Room 4 ("The Fishbowl")

Quick guide for the facilities desk at Pellwyn Court. Room 4 is our secure interview room — glass walls, but soundproofed, honest. Bookings come through the Reservo board; double-check before letting anyone in, as recruiters get twitchy about overlaps. Candidates are always escorted, never left alone with the door unlocked. Cleaners need the keypad rather than a badge, so give them the code below.

staff pass of kawip-hawef = bdg-QLP-2

Nice cleanup of the dispatch loop in LiftSim! One thing though: the idle-car reassignment logic in `rebalance()` now runs every tick, which feels wasteful given the hall-call queue is usually empty overnight. Maybe gate it behind the same cooldown we use for door-dwell recalcs? Also, the hysteresis on floor-clustering looks hand-tuned — would love a comment explaining where the numbers came from. For reference while you review, these are the constants the simulator currently ships with.

constants for bawif-kawif:
QUOTAS = {
    "ulaael": 5,
    "holael": 10,
}

Handover Note — Director Transition, Quillbrook Appliances

To the incoming heads: the warranty-cost overrun on the Fenmore dryer line now exceeds the reserve by roughly 18%. Root-cause work points to a supplier heating element; claims data through last month is attached. Please review the accrual adjustments carefully, and note the confidential business context appended directly below this note.

internal memo for yahag-tahog: The pricing group signed off on a budget of $152.8 million for Project Soriel.